Yale Interns Develop Fun Orientation Video

This summer YPPS and several other Yale departments had the good fortune to work with several New Haven Promise(NHP) interns. In mid-June three interns (from YPPS, HR and Administration) and their managers discussed the possibility of a group video project over lunch. During the past two months, six interns from four departments worked together to create a fun orientation video for their peers.

After several planning meetings and filming sessions, they produced a useful and amusing guide to navigating the workforce as a New Haven Promise student interning at Yale. In this 3-minute video, the interns talk about the Dos and Don’ts of working in an office and about their personal experiences and what they learned. The video was given as a surprise to Chris Brown, Director of New Haven Community Hiring Initiatives at Yale. He was impressed by the quality and the overall message. Chris is going to use it during future orientations for new interns.  It will also be posted on the New Have Promise website http://newhavenpromise.org/.
